Study of Gas Hydrate Formation in the Carbon Dioxide plus Hydrogen plus Water Systems: Compositional Analysis of the Gas Phase

Molar compositions of carbon dioxide (and hydrogen) in the gas phase in equilibrium with gas hydrate and aqueous phases were measured for various (H-2 + CO2) gas mixtures + water systems in the temperature range of 273.6-281.2 K at pressures up to similar to 9 MPa. The compositions of the gas phase were measured using an isochoric technique, in combination with the ROLSI capillary gas-phase sampling and a gas chromatography technique. The compositional data generated in this work are compared with the literature data, and the agreement is found to be generally acceptable.
